Job Description
As a Mechanical Design Engineer on the Sensor Cleaning team, you will play a critical role in ensuring Zoox vehicles can operate safely and reliably in real-world environments. You will be responsible for developing, integrating, validating, and launching sensor cleaning systems that maintain the performance of cameras, lidars, and other perception sensors across a wide range of weather and contamination conditions.
you will drive engineering solutions that ensure sensors remain within operational specifications, minimize contamination-related failures, reduce supply chain and manufacturing yield losses, improve vehicle availability, and support scalable deployment of Zoox autonomous vehicles.
- Develop sensor cleaning components and systems to keep sensors free of contaminants.
- Perform packaging studies, tolerance analysis, DFMEA, DFM/DFA, and reliability assessments.
- Design and build mockups, proofs of concept, and functional prototypes
- Develop and release CAD models, engineering drawings, and BOMs.
- Support test engineering, sensor performance engineers, and validation teams in test design, failure analysis, and quality management
- Collaborate with manufacturing engineers and quality engineer to ramp production processes and meet build objectives
- Maintain BOMs, documenting and approving build processes, and supporting quality and cost engineering throughout the supply chain of the assemblies
- Collaborate with suppliers to develop prototypes, resolve technical issues, and support manufacturing readiness.
